Output ed8668c1c475ad0e0b9afb3a6db5228ac80dbb318530829fc3011532e89ec5f2:1

value
4608805624
script pubkey
OP_0 OP_PUSHBYTES_20 115ef5bf05fde040c375336de6eed8aed0d5b85b
address
tb1qz900t0c9lhsypsm4xdk7dmkc4mgdtwzmrp4fu3
transaction
ed8668c1c475ad0e0b9afb3a6db5228ac80dbb318530829fc3011532e89ec5f2